The chilly October nights will be rolling in, and what better way to warm up than Upstairs at Cleaver & Wake for their seasonal cheese & wine tasting evening!
Join them on Friday 25th October as they host another of their popular cheese & wine tasting evenings with Autumnal touches throughout. Their in-house sommelier, Linzi, will talk you through six different wines including sparkling, red, white, rosé and dessert wine, which will be perfectly paired with a cheese board featuring local, British and international cheeses.
Tickets are £45 and include six different types of wine, six cheeses and chutneys.
